PRO CAREER
- Has started at left tackle in 33 games
- Became the first Steelers rookie to start at left tackle since the 1970 AFL-NFL merger
- Made NFL debut in Week 1 of 2021 (at Buffalo)
- Made NFL starting debut in Week 1 of 2021 (at Buffalo)
2022 (STEELERS)
- Started all 17 regular-season games at left tackle
- Blocked for a 1,000-plus-yard rusher for a second consecutive season
- Blocked for RB Najee Harris to run for 111 yards in Week 17 at Baltimore
- Part of an offensive line that did not allow a sack in two games and just one sack in four games
2021 (STEELERS)
- Started 16 regular-season games at left tackle
- Blocked for 1,000-plus-yard rusher Najee Harris
- Was one of five rookie starters, marking the first time the Steelers started at least five rookies in a season opener since 1991
- Blocked for a 100-yard rusher three times (Week 5 vs. Denver; Week 10 vs. Detroit; Week 17 vs. Cleveland)
- Joined C Maurkice Pouncey to become one of two offensive linemen in franchise history to start 16 games their rookie season
COLLEGE
- Played in 44 games (37 starts) at Texas A&M (2017-20)
- Started the final 36 games of his collegiate career
- Named Second-Team All-SEC as a senior in 2020
- Started all 10 games and logged 691 snaps at left tackle
- Helped the Aggies rack up 543 yards of offense in the win over Florida, including 205 on the ground
- Protected QB Kellen Mond and did not allow a sack for the third straight game while also only giving up one tackle for loss on the final play of the game at Mississippi State
- Helped the Aggies tally 530 yards of total offense in the dominating 48-3 win at South Carolina, including 264 on the ground
- Earned SEC Offensive Lineman of the Week honors for his performance against the Gamecocks
- Rolled over the Tigers defense for a season-high 313 yards rushing in the victory at Auburn
- Texas A&M offensive line was named a finalist for the Joe Moore Award
